On an island there are 100 people each of whom is either a knight or a spy. There are more knights than spies. Knights always answer truthfully, spies may or may not answer truthfully. You (not one of the 100) can ask any person on the island about the nature of some other person on the island (this counts as 1 question). You are allowed 150 questions. Can you definitely determine the nature of all the people on the island? (If no, give an example with proof, if yes give an algorithm for doing it) |
